CARBONDALE, IL (April 10, 2014) -- SIU Credit Union, with the assistance of The American Red Cross, will host a community blood drive on Thursday, April 24. The event takes place between 10 a.m. – 2 p.m in the parking lot of SIU Credit Union’s Giant City Road branch near Kroger in Carbondale, located at 395 N. Giant City Road. Blood Donation Facts:
- Every two seconds someone in the U.S. needs blood.
- More than 41,000 blood donations are needed every day.
- Although an estimated 38% of the U.S. population is eligible to donate, less than 10% actually do each year.
- Blood donation is a simple four-step process: registration, medical history and mini-physical, donation and refreshments.
- The actual blood donation typically takes less than 10-12 minutes. The entire process, from the time you arrive to the time you leave, takes about an hour and 15 min.
